About Weston School District
The Weston School District, in beautiful Sauk and Richland counties, is situated on 60 acres in the midst of cornfields and woodlands. Even though the district is small, Weston's 300 PreK-12 grade students experience a challenging academic environment with a wide array of athletic, artistic, technical, vocational, exploratory, and college-level course offerings. What Is the Cost of Living Near Madison?

Understanding the cost of living near Madison is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Weston School District.
Madison's Cost of Living Index is approximately 100.8 (0.8% more expensive than US average; 6.3% more than WI average). State capital (Univ. of WI), desirable, housing costs near US avg.
